Set the media feeding
Correct the feeding rate of media.
If the correction value is not appropriate, stripes may appear on the printed image, thus resulting in a poor
printing.
Setting Feed Correction
A pattern for media correction is printed and a media-feeding rate is corrected.
1
Set a media. ( P.2-5)
2
Press the key in LOCAL.
3
Press the key.
4
Press the key to print a correction pattern.
5
Check the correction pattern and enter a correction
value.
Enter a correction value in "+": The boundary between the two bands is widened.
Enter a correction value in "-": The boundary between the two bands is narrowed.
When you have changed the media type, check the pattern and perform adjustment depending on the
status.
If the heater temperature is changed, start the correction after confirmed by checking the temperature
panel of heater that the temperature has reached the set temperature.
When printing with a take-up device, set the media first and then perform media correction.
If the adsorption fan is used, start the media correction after turning on the adsorption fan.
Two bands are printed in the correction pattern.
Make adjustment so that an even color density is obtained in the boundary between the two bands.
